Fig. 40. Checkweighing display content
1 measurement result
2 pictogram of stable measurement result
3 working mode name
4 the value of HI threshold (limit)
5 the value of LO threshold (limit)
6 a pictogram indicating the weighing range of currently weighed sample
(LO OK.- HI)
7 name of a product saved in the database of thresholds
8 difference between the measurement result and the center of set tolerance field
9 a pictogram indicating the current “place” of weighed sample in relation to set
checkweighing thresholds (limits)
10 a bargraph indicating the range of applied measuring range of a balance.
Selecting other product from the database of thresholds (limits)
While in checkweighing mode press SETUP key
A message box is opened on the display. Go to the database of thresholds (limits)
and select another record from the database or set other HI and LO thresholds
values if the database is disabled)
